Christopher Khanh Thien Pham, D.O.

According to 2025 Medicare claims, Christopher Pham, D.O. (NPI: 1336565225) practices sleep medicine in the Pittsburgh, PA market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Allegheny, PA.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is ALLEGHENY CLINIC (NPI: 1063650919; TIN: 251838458) and primary practice location at 15237-5803. Pham is affiliated with the Physician Partners of Western PA LLC (ACO ID: A3547) and ACO West Virginia (ACO ID: A3563), participating under the MSSP model.

Pham's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 376 traditional Medicare patients, billed 446 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$35,389 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was 95811 (Sleep study in sleep lab with continuous airway pressure (6 years or older)). Part D data shows 442 prescription claims across 111 beneficiaries totaling $64,370 in drug costs, led by Belsomra (Suvorexant). DME data shows 1,308 claims.
